### Changelog — v2.8.0

Renamed `EXPORT_RETRY_ON` to `EXPORT_RETRY_ENABLED` because half the team kept reading the old name backwards. Retries for failed exports now back off exponentially, capped at five attempts. Old name still works until v3.0 but logs a grumpy warning. While migrating your `.env`, also re-add the export signing secret, which goes on the following line.

sealed setting: ARCHIVE_KEY3=8d0

### Step 4: Point Invoicelope at the new renderer database

Okay, this is the step everyone trips on. The old PDF renderer kept invoice templates on local disk; the new one (Papertrout) pulls them from the rendering DB instead. Make sure you've run the schema sync from Step 3 first, otherwise Papertrout will boot but render blank invoices, which is deeply unhelpful. Once the sync finishes cleanly, update your local config with the connection string below.

replica DSN, kajep-yahag: mssql://praok_svc:iF@db-8d68.plorvaio.local:5432/eliion

- [ ] **Validator plugin registry sanity check** — Before flipping the Sievewright plugin system live, load each third-party validator in the Dryrun sandbox and confirm none of them panic on the empty-schema case (yes, it happened last quarter). On-call: keep the legacy validators hot for 24h as fallback, and watch the rejection-rate dashboard for anything above 2%. If a plugin misbehaves, disable it via the registry toggle rather than rolling back. Verify the sandbox run matches the build noted below.

pipeline stamp: htk31_f769b577b3028a4e9958e5bb8d1259a

**14:22 — Compaction stall confirmed on Pipewren queue cluster.** The log compaction job on partition group C had been holding its lock for 40 minutes, blocking consumer offset commits. New readers: this is why consumer lag spiked without any producer-side change. The on-call restarted the compactor with the patched build, and lag drained within ten minutes. That build's trace token is recorded below.

build token for kagaf-hahof: htk14_9d3d4d26d7d8de